COUNCIL MEMORANDUM <br /> #2015 - 01 <br /> DATE: January 7, 2015 <br /> TO: Honorable Mayor Michael T. McElroy and City Council <br /> FROM: Gregg D. Zientara, Interim City Manager <br /> SUBJECT: City Code Chapter 7 Amendment <br /> SUMMARY RECOMMENDATION: Staff recommends that City Council (approve the attached <br /> ordinance regarding an addition to Chapter 7 of City Code, to provide for the position of <br /> Executive Assistant in the City Manager's Office. <br /> BACKGROUND: The position of Administrative Secretary in the City Manager's Office was <br /> recently vacated. In an effort to consolidate duties and provide for a higher level of assistance <br /> in this office prior to the appointment of a replacement, it is now recommended that the position <br /> of Executive Assistant be created to supersede the position of Administrative Secretary. Duties <br /> of the new position would include those of the Administrative Secretary, but would also <br /> encompass a number of additional responsibilities not previously assigned to the position. For <br /> this reason, it is recommended the new position be created and the current one be eliminated. <br /> In order to implement this recommendation, Council's approval of the attached change in City <br /> Code Chapter 7, Section 2 is required. The title of"Executive Assistant" would be added to the <br /> document. It is recommended that the change take effect immediately upon approval by <br /> Council. <br /> POTENTIAL OBJECTIONS: There are no known objectors to this change. <br /> INPUT FROM OTHER SOURCES: None. <br /> STAFF REFERENCE: Questions regarding the ordinance should be directed to me, at 424- <br /> 2801 or gzientara(a)-decaturil.aov. <br /> BUDGET/TIME IMPLICATIONS: There would be no net change in the number of authorized <br /> positions in the department. The 2015 budget as approved by City Council on December 1, <br /> 2014, includes funding for the proposed position. <br /> Attachment <br />
